当前位置: 首页 > 专利查询>常州大学专利>正文

基于区块链和T-CP-ABE的病历存储和共享系统技术方案

技术编号:41738919 阅读:15 留言:0更新日期:2024-06-19 12:58
本发明专利技术涉及电子病历系统技术领域,尤其涉及基于区块链和T‑CP‑ABE的病历存储和共享系统,包括星际文件系统用于存储患者加密后的病历数据以及医生加密后的诊断结果;T‑CP‑ABE系统生成公钥、主密钥和私钥,利用公钥和主密钥加密患者信息;依据医生属性集分配私钥,满足患者定义的访问策略的医生解密患者信息;区块链用于病历信息、诊断结果存储,并对密钥进行管理,追溯病历的访问和诊断记录。本发明专利技术减轻患者和区块链上的存储压力,实现数据的可信存储与不可篡改,同时避免中心化存储带来的单点故障问题;防止授权访问者与未授权者的共谋问题,以便数据拥有者及时更新密钥,杜绝电子病历的非法篡改,提高区块链的性能。

【技术实现步骤摘要】

本专利技术涉及电子病历系统,尤其涉及基于区块链和t-cp-abe的病历存储和共享系统。


技术介绍

1、医院通常将电子病历数据存储在第三方云设备中,但电子病历的数据泄露事件频频发生,导致患者医疗健康隐私暴露;因此,保障电子病历存储的机密性、不可篡改性和完整性对于医疗安全和服务质量至关重要。

2、密文策略的访问控制(ciphertext policy attribute based encryption,cp-abe)被视为一种细粒度访问控制机制;数据所有者可以制定访问策略,只有满足要求的访问者才能使用其私钥解密。但授权用户者有着和非法访问者的共谋活动的可能。

3、gao s等人的a trustworthy secure ciphertext-policy and attributehiding access control scheme based on blockchain,将访问控制写进智能合约中,这种方式会使得访问控制的策略不可更改和难以扩展,无法满足灵活变化的场景,且访问策略过于复杂时会降低区块链中节点的运行效率。

...

【技术保护点】

1.基于区块链和T-CP-ABE的病历存储和共享系统,其特征在于,包括:星际文件系统、区块链、T-CP-ABE系统、患者和医生;其中,

2.根据权利要求1所述的基于区块链和T-CP-ABE的病历存储和共享系统,其特征在于,T-CP-ABE系统包括:系统初始化、密钥生成、数据加密、数据解密和跟踪过程;其中,

3.根据权利要求1所述的基于区块链和T-CP-ABE的病历存储和共享系统,其特征在于,患者拥有自身病历的控制权,通过设置访问控制权限限制病历的访问者。

4.根据权利要求1所述的基于区块链和T-CP-ABE的病历存储和共享系统,其特征在于,医生满足访问...

【技术特征摘要】

1.基于区块链和t-cp-abe的病历存储和共享系统,其特征在于,包括:星际文件系统、区块链、t-cp-abe系统、患者和医生;其中,

2.根据权利要求1所述的基于区块链和t-cp-abe的病历存储和共享系统,其特征在于,t-cp-abe系统包括:系统初始化、密钥生成、数据加密、数据解密和跟踪过程;其中,

3.根据权利要求1所述的基于区块链和t-cp-abe的病历存储和共享系统,其特征在于,患者拥有自身病历的控制权,通过设置访问控制权限限制病历的访问者。

4.根据权利要求1所述的基于区块链和t-cp-abe的病历存储和共享系统,其特征在于,医生满足访问策略获取患者信息、病历存储地址、以及解密病历和加密诊断信息的密钥。

5.根据权利要求1所述的基于区块链和t-cp-abe的病历存储和共享系统,其特征在于,不同医生拥有不同权限,当医生仅访问患者病历不提供诊断服务时,患者不会为医生分配用于加密诊断结果的密钥。

【专利技术属性】
技术研发人员:张华君杨琴黄道旗张羽
申请(专利权)人:常州大学
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1